Transaction 39afc130d22f4eaf1fff63deb7eeab09037cdb9ee19185a53bcec8606eb94685
1 Input
1 Output
-
39afc130d22f4eaf1fff63deb7eeab09037cdb9ee19185a53bcec8606eb94685:0
- value
- 828819
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b40e08e4a34c2e612a4bcb7bbb1f7e469d31d95e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HR3SgTFoLqqXT9v66HZqJuP9xvDVGvcue